Newport Lutheran Church in Wisconsin Dells, WI 53965

Business Contact Details

  • Address

    N8794 Peterson Rd
    Wisconsin Dells, WI 53965

    Phone Number

    (608) 742-4286

More Business Info & Hours

More Churches